The Cute Daisy May and WhoopsiDaisy studio is a new sponsor of the Cuttlebug Challenge - watch for upcoming features in September - so I wanted to try out Linnie's precious digital images. This darling little lady is the first that I colored with my Copics and Smooches, and it's for a challenge on their blog, calling for Blue and Green...

There are four images on a sheet when you download them, so I have three more of these cuties waiting to come to life. I cut the oval and the scallop with Nestabilities, and the blue paper is the brand new Glitter Core'dinations - OH, MY how yummy!!! The label behind is the ALL GIRL cut from LACY LABELS Cricut Cartridge, distressed in green, and dressed up with three different sized pearls. The ribbon is from Offray, and it all sits on velvety flocked paper from DCWV.
